For Immediate Release: December 4, 2019
Statement by Mayor Kawakami on Pearl Harbor shooting
LIHUE — Mayor Derek S.K. Kawakami has issued the following statement regarding
Wednesday's shooting at the Pearl Harbor Naval Shipyard.
"We are all shaken by this senseless act of violence. All of Hawaii hurts when our
`ohana gets hurt. Our hearts go out to the victims and their families, and all who serve our
Country at the shipyard. We send our thoughts and prayers during this very difficult time." —
Mayor Derek S. K. Kawakami
